Chapter 97 "buying and selling"

Led by the direct line, the war-weariness of the frontline officers and soldiers was high, and the generals of the Northern Army also began to show slack.As soon as Cao Kun left, Zhang Huaizhi, the governor of Shandong, followed him. The reason given to Duan Qirui was that "the two provinces of Hunan and Jiangxi do not need to inspect", and he had to "return to Lu to suppress the bandits". Seeing that all the units of the Northern Army were sneaking away, Zhang Jingyao, who had just become the Governor of Hunan, couldn't help being flustered, and even sent a telegram, requesting a temporary truce and negotiating peace with the Southern Army.Lao Duan replied and reprimanded him severely, and strictly ordered that there is no order from the Central Committee to stop the war and negotiate peace.

Zhang Jingyao is a member of the department, and Duan Qirui can reprimand and restrain him and not allow him to cease fighting and negotiate a peace, but Zhang's strength is limited and it is embarrassing for him to take on the task.Apart from his Anhui Clan, the only thing Duan Qirui can rely on is the Feng Clan.Duan Qirui and Xu Shuzheng planned to set up the Fengjun Front Enemy Headquarters in Hankou, and put all the Fengjun troops in the pass into the Hunan battlefield, and continue to fight against the southern army. The problem is that Feng Jun is neither his old Duan nor Xiao Xu's. In the final analysis, it belongs to Zhang Zuolin.With the rest of the northern army retreating or watching from the sidelines, how could Zhang Zuolin bet his own capital on the Anhui faction?

Cao Kun and Zhang Huaizhi refused to listen to the restraints, and Fengjun did not use them. Seeing that the dream of unifying the north and the south might come to naught, Duan Qirui called Xu Shuzheng and sighed: "This setback is really unexpected." While the Civil War was going on, another war without gunpowder in the capital was also reaching its climax, which was the election of the new Congress. Since Feng Guozhang took office in Beijing, his identity has always been the acting president, not the official president.During this period, Duan Qirui established the Provisional Senate. The establishment of this institution not only provided a convenient way for the main fighters to "legally drive Feng away", but also gave Feng Guozhang an opportunity to help Zheng become the official president.After Duan Qirui resigned and stepped down, Feng Guozhang secretly asked his subordinates to help him plan and prepare in advance.

The staff of Feng Mu lacked research on the constitution and congressional elections. Finally, they were recommended by someone to call Chief Financial Officer Wang Kemin to the Presidential Palace and ask him to handle this "sale". Wang Kemin was very happy to hear that he was asked to do this at first, but after thinking about it carefully after returning home, he thought it should be done carefully.The reason is that Feng Guozhang is famous for being stingy with money. If he plays tricks at that time and asks Wang Kemin to borrow money from the Ministry of Finance or the bank to advance the event expenses, he will lose a lot.

Wang Kemin made up his mind that Feng Guozhang would only agree to help if he was willing to pay for it himself.So he invited the Secretary-General of the Presidential Palace, Zhang Yiling, to meet with Feng Guozhang the next day, and immediately proposed that the matter required two million yuan. Feng Guozhang was taken aback when he heard this, and after a while he reluctantly said: "There is an interest of 400,000 yuan remitted from Nanjing, let's use it first." Feng Guozhang handed over a check of 400,000 yuan to Wang Kemin, and solemnly said to him: "This matter must be done with confidence."

The funds have been reduced to 20% off, and Wang Kemin is really speechless, and at the same time he is thankful that he has the foresight.He quickly handed over the check to the Constitutional Research Institute, and asked the Institute to take care of it, and then declared to Feng Mu's staff: "Just this one time, don't worry about it next time!" The person in charge of the research association is a businessman from Shanxi, and he has to plan carefully in everything. Knowing that the funds are taken out of his own pocket by the president, he dare not neglect.He distributed 400,000 yuan to the old members of parliament in Beijing from various provinces, and asked these people to return to their hometowns to "handle" elections-each person was given 2,000 yuan for travel expenses and travel expenses, up to the limit of being elected. return.

At this time, the old Congress had been disbanded for nearly a year, and the members were poor in the capital, financially struggling.After hearing about this method, many people were reluctant to go back to their hometowns to "handle", fearing that if Feng Guozhang was not elected, he would not be able to repay the debt. Although Feng Guozhang spent a lot of money and made preparations, he obviously lacked confidence in the election of the new Congress, so he regarded the introduction of the "Congress Organization Law" and other regulations as a threat.In fact, Feng Guozhang's level and skills in operating politics cannot be compared with Duan Qirui and Xu Shuzheng, and the Constitution Research Association is definitely not an opponent of the Anfu Department.

The title of Anfu Department began during the session of the Provisional Senate.At that time, Xu Shuzheng asked Wang Yitang, who was also from the Duan School, to rent a relatively large courtyard house in Anfu Hutong, Xicheng, Beijing. The councilors meeting in Liang's house had neither organization nor leadership, but they just sat there casually at night when there was nothing to do.There were not many people at that time, or three or five people, or more than ten people, chatting with each other.Although the content of chats sometimes involves political issues, there is no form of meeting, just exchanging political opinions and connecting feelings between colleagues.

Later, knowing that the number of people in Liang's house was increasing day by day, entertainment facilities were added, such as chess, mahjong and so on.In this way, Liang's house also has the nature of a club.
